It is looking to be a pretty cold Valentine's Day but six-time Apollo winner Tarrey Torae will be warming things up in a live-streamed concert 7 p.m. Valentine's Day Weekend, Saturday, Feb. 13. This concert is part of the Eighth Blackbird Presents: The Chicago Artists Workshop (CAW) live concert series. Because this concert will be live streamed, everyone can enjoy the concert with the one they love in the toasty comfort of home.
In this concert, Torae, joined by her husband J. Ivy, will be performing songs from her upcoming album of love songs, "Catching Feelings." Their combined musical talent and emotional chemistry is guaranteed to be a great Valentine's Day weekend date night experience.
Torae has appeared and written on two GRAMMY winning albums for her work with Kanye West and John Legend and was recently featured as vocalist on the Chicago Bulls' MLK Day Tribute . Other performance credits include several national tours including a 55-city Coca Cola NAACP Tour, the Nissan/Essence Magazine Moyo Music Mix Tour, The Rock the Bells Festival Tour and Lollapalooza. She has also performed on stages with The Roots, Common, Patti Labelle and Stevie Wonder and shared stages with Jill Scott, Mos Def, Nas and Usher among others.
Tarrey Torae: "Catching Feelings" live streamed concert will be staged at the Eighth Blackbird production facility located at 4045 N. Rockwell St. Suggested price per household is $20,but options include choosing a price as well as contributing as a supporter. The event will include an interview and a Q&A with the artist.
